excel怎么一列求和公式-Excel一列求和公式
在数据驱动的商业决策和财务分析中,Excel 作为最普及的办公工具,其核心功能之一便是数据求和。如何让一列复杂的数值数据准确、高效地求和,往往让人陷入无从下手或公式错误的困境。经过十余年的深耕,界域职考网xinlishi.cc 专注于此,致力于解决大家在实际操作中遇到的各种瓶颈问题。本文将从三个关键维度,深入剖析 Excel 一列求和公式的底层逻辑、高级技巧以及潜在陷阱,并配以丰富的实例说明。

Excel 的求和功能核心在于 SUM 函数,其基本语法为 SUM(参数列表)。在实际应用中,只需将“添加”按钮拖向数据区域,并在单元格内输入 SUM 函数即可实现累加。
例如,计算 A1 到 A100 的总和,公式为 SUM(A1:A100)。这种简单粗暴的方法适用于数据分布均匀、没有特殊格式的常规场景。
面对数据混乱、包含文本、跨越不同单元格的复杂情况,基础公式往往显得力不从心。此时,我们需要引入过滤条件或 VBA 宏来增强灵活性。对于频繁使用、需要个性化处理的批量操作,自定义函数则成为最佳选择,它能将复杂的逻辑封装在代码中,实现“一次编写,处处复用”的高效性。
进阶篇:处理特殊格式与动态范围在实际数据录入中,往往会出现“带符号的数值”或“跨列求和”的需求。
例如,某列数据既有数字也有文本描述,如何只累加数字部分?或者需要将 A 列和 B 列对应位置的数据合并计算?这些问题需要通过查找与引用技巧来解决。
对于跨列相加,必须注意区域闭合问题。直接输入 SUM(A1:B10) 有时会导致结果异常,因为 Excel 默认只计算包含“列标题”或分隔符的单元格。解决方法是利用 HLOOKUP 函数配合 SUM,或者更严谨地使用 SUMPRODUCT 函数,后者能更灵活地处理任意形状的数组,极大提升了处理不规则数据的效率。
此外,动态范围和数组公式也是提升求和功能的重要手段。在数据源频繁变动时,使用 OFFSET 函数配合动态范围,可以确保求和区域紧跟数据变化,避免公式失效。而在处理大量数据时,数组公式虽能一次性计算多列,但需注意兼容性,建议在支持 Excel 365 的电脑中启用,以提高运算速度。
高级篇:自动化与性能优化随着数据量的爆炸式增长,手工计算已成历史。此时,借助 VBA 宏技术实现自动化求和,是专业工作者追求效率的终极体现。通过编写简单的宏脚本,用户可以在不操作的前提下,自动处理成千上万行的数据,甚至支持自定义逻辑判断(如只统计正数之和)。
宏的引入也带来了性能风险。如果数据量过大或代码逻辑复杂,宏运行会导致系统卡顿。
因此,必须遵循“小步快跑”和“参数化”原则。
例如,将宏中的数字范围作为参数传递,而非硬编码。
于此同时呢,定期备份工作簿并开启“启用宏”选项,是保障数据安全的前提。
在最终方案的选择上,界域职考网xinlishi.cc 建议优先评估数据源的特性。若是静态数据,固定公式最稳妥;若是动态合并工作表,动态数组或宏则表现更佳。无论选择哪种方式,核心原则始终不变:公式必须清晰、独立且易于维护。
希望本文能为大家在 Excel 求和之旅中找到方向,如有更多疑问,欢迎访问界域职考网xinlishi.cc 获取专业帮助。